Public bug reported:

I’ve always used System Monitor and kept it running on a workspace, to
see how my system is running and doing. Sometimes a browser starts
running weird, slow and balky. I check on System to find out which
Process is causing this and shut it down, to get things running better
again. It always ran fine and was very stable on earlier versions of
Ubuntu. However on 24.04 it crashes very often.

This never happened before. What may be causing System Monitor to crash
so often with 24.04?
